“I'm between a 3 and a 4. Depends on the items. What I like? - Chicken tortilla soup which is quite flavorful though a tad salty - Crispy signature fish tacos with black beans and rice: a generous portion, perfectly crispy, fresh ingredients, nice and balanced. The hot sauce on the side is excellent and packs a good punch. What I'll skip: - blackened fish tacos: lacking in flavor - rice bowl which I had with the signature crispy fish: the combo of vegetables isn't right. It shouldn't have raw carrot cubes and lots of raw bell peppers and corn. There's also too much mayo. I'll go tacos next time. Excellent and quick and helpful and efficient service. It's also a fine fast casual space. I appreciate that there are plates and utensils and takeout containers out to speed up the dining experience.“
